Who is Jimmy Carr’s partner?
Karoline Copping is a Canadian-born television commissioning editor. She has held senior programming roles in British TV, including at Channel 5, with earlier work connected to Channel 4 and Comedy Central — the sort of behind-the-camera job that shapes what gets made without ever putting her in front of it.
That matters, because it explains why she’s so hard to pin down online. Copping keeps a deliberately low profile: no public social media presence to speak of, and she doesn’t give interviews about her private life. In an era when most celebrity partners eventually do a magazine spread, she simply hasn’t. What we know about the relationship comes almost entirely from Carr’s side.
So when you see a page calling her “Jimmy Carr’s wife,” read it as shorthand — and an inaccurate one. They’ve built a 20-plus-year partnership without marrying, and Copping is his partner rather than his spouse. Relationship timeline: how Jimmy Carr and Karoline Copping got together
Here’s the sequence, kept to what’s actually been reported:
- 2001 — they meet. The pair crossed paths through work in television early in Carr’s career, before he was a household name.
- An unpromising start. By Carr’s own retelling, Copping was not immediately won over by him or his comedy. He’s joked that his material didn’t land with her at first — hardly the stuff of a fairy-tale opening.
- Persistence pays off. He kept at it, they started dating, and the relationship stuck where a lot of showbiz couplings don’t.
- Two decades together. They settled into a long-term home life in north London, staying notably private throughout Carr’s rise to prime-time fame.
- 2019 — their son is born. After roughly 18 years together, the couple had their first child.
The through-line is stability. While Carr’s on-stage persona trades in shock, his home life has been about as steady and low-drama as a public figure’s gets.

Jimmy Carr’s son and his unusual name
The couple’s son was born in 2019. His name is Rockefeller — and yes, there’s a story behind it. Carr has explained the name draws on the American industrialist John D. Rockefeller and, playfully, comedian Chris Rock. The birth itself was kept quiet at the time and revealed later rather than announced in the moment.
Carr has since spoken about the delivery on the Parenting Hell podcast with Rob Beckett and Josh Widdicombe, describing an emergency caesarean and calling the experience genuinely frightening — a candid, un-jokey account of new fatherhood from a man not known for lowering his guard.
